Betty and Lee Tafoya – Santa Clara Pueblo

Signature of Betty and Lee Tafoya – Santa Clara PuebloLee Tafoya (b.1926- ), grandson of Sara Fina Tafoya and the son of Margaret Tafoya, and his wife, Betty, are the parents of Phyllis Tafoya, Melvin Tafoya, and Linda Tafoya Oyenque, all of whom also are potters of renown.  Lee and Betty work together and co-sign their pottery.

 

This jar is an excellent example of the high quality of their pottery.  The carving was executed in a precise and expert manner, the burnishing finished in a very high sheen, and the firing controlled to produce a deep black luster.
